Output 768ac22893fea21b57e151b4d274d974c562525ffa4af18a8c7fac6dfe93074f: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d33b5b0a25901406d9fb0a2117a0e23632112f7 OP_EQUAL
address
3BeRXJpYHGhwfCaGa6PGdpbqBszzRF9eoE
transaction
768ac22893fea21b57e151b4d274d974c562525ffa4af18a8c7fac6dfe93074f
spent
true